首页
登录
从业资格
设有关系模式R(A1,A2,A3,A4,A5,A6),其中:函数依赖集F={A1
设有关系模式R(A1,A2,A3,A4,A5,A6),其中:函数依赖集F={A1
练习题库
2022-08-02
36
问题
设有关系模式R(A1,A2,A3,A4,A5,A6),其中:函数依赖集F={A1→A2,A1A3→A4,A5A6→A1,A2A5→A6,A3A5→A6},则( )关系模式R 的一个主键,R规范化程度最高达到( )。问题1选项A.A1A4B.A2A4C.A3A5D.A4A5问题2选项A.1NFB.2NFC.3NFD.BCNF
选项
答案
CB
解析
求候选码:关系模式码的确定,设关系模式R<U,F>:1、首先应该找出F中所有的决定因素,即找出出现在函数依赖规则中“→”左边的所有属性,组成集合U1;2、再从U1中找出一个属性或属性组K,运用Armstrong公理系统及推论,使得K→U,而K真子集K′→U不成立;这样就得到了关系模式R的一个候选码,找遍U1属性的所有组合,重复过程(2),最终得到关系模式R的所有候选码。
在本题中 U1={ A1、A2、A3、A5、A6}
A3A5→A6,A5A6→A1利用伪传递率:A3A5→A1,A1→A2利用传递率:A3A5→A2
A3A5→A1,A1A3→A4利用伪传递率:A3A5→A4
因此A3A5→{ A1,A2,A3,A4,A5,A6}
注:Armstrong公理系统及推论如下:
自反律:若Y?X?U,则X→Y为F所逻辑蕴含
增广律:若X→Y为F所逻辑蕴含,且Z?U,则XZ→YZ为F所逻辑蕴含
传递律:若X→Y和Y→Z为F所逻辑蕴含,则X→Z为F所逻辑蕴含
合并规则:若X→Y, X→Z,则X→YZ为F所蕴涵
伪传递率:若X→Y, WY→Z,则XW→Z为F所蕴涵
分解规则:若X→Y,Z?Y,则X→Z为F所蕴涵
由于函数依赖中存在传递依赖,所以不满足3NF的要求
转载请注明原文地址:https://tihaiku.com/congyezige/2417943.html
本试题收录于:
中级 软件评测师题库软件水平考试初中高级分类
中级 软件评测师
软件水平考试初中高级
相关试题推荐
阅读以下两个说明、C函数和问题,将解答写入答题纸的对应栏内。 【说明1】
阅读以下说明、C函数和问题,将解答填入答题纸的对应栏内。 【说明】
阅读以下说明和C函数,将应填入(n)处的字句写在答题纸的对应栏内。 【说明】
阅读以下说明和C函数,将应填入(n)处的字句写在答题纸的对应栏内。 【说明
函数f()、g()的定义如下所示,已知调用f时传递给其形参x的值是3,若以传值方
某银行数据库中,信贷额度关系模式为Credit-in(用户账号,信贷额度,已用金
某银行数据库中,信贷额度关系模式为Credit-in(用户账号,信贷额度,已用金
某银行数据库中,信贷额度关系模式为Credit-in(用户账号,信贷额度,已用金
某银行数据库中,信贷额度关系模式为Credit-in(用户账号,信贷额度,已用金
函数g和f的定义如下所示,其中,a是全局变量。若在函数g中以引用调用(call
随机试题
Weallassociatecolorswithfeelingsandattitudes.Inpoliticsdarkblueo
Forthispart,youareallowed30minutestowriteashortessayentitledMenace
Somepeoplethinktheyhavean【B1】______totheproblemsofautomobilecrowdi
刘某,男,46岁,年幼时父母离异,现在跟父亲和姐姐一起生活,不再与母亲来往,刘某
地方各级人民政府应当按照国家有关规定向()人民政府报送突发事件信息。A.各
患者男性,57岁,晚饭后散步1小时,回家后饮水500ml,突感腰腹部剧烈疼痛,伴
2020年8月11日电,根据十三届全国人大常委会第二十一次会议的决定,授予
A.青霉素 B.氯霉素 C.两性霉素B D.克林霉素 E.克霉唑仅局部用
银行承兑汇票的承兑银行,应当按照票面金额向出票人收取()的手续费。A:千分之一
(2021年第2批真题)建设工程项目总进度目标论证的主要工作有:①进行项目结构分
最新回复
(
0
)